Jill’s at the St Julien: A hidden gem in Boulder

It’s a diamond in the expanse of Boulder dining, and yet one largely unknown. The entire property is an ideal draw for a fancy night out, not only because Jill’s is a one-of-a-kind concept, but because it’s a place to spend an entire evening: drinks beforehand at T-Zero Bar, appetizers and music on the patio, and a full meal in the elegant dining room.

Explosions in the Sky gave Boulder Theater audience sonic reverb, symphonic melodies

The April 5 show at the Boulder Theater was no exception. Tlast night’s show at the Boulder Theater was no exception. The audience was pinned to the floor by these rock mini-symphonies, being pushed and pulled by the weight of the band’s reverb and heavy distortion, coming close to the head-crushing level of sonic power of My Bloody Valentine, then dipping down into beautiful, delicate instrumentation reminiscent of Sigur Ros.
